Abstract
Two species of Succineidae, belonging to different subfami lies, are reported from Bhutan. Succinea rutilans, described from the Khasi hills, is one more indication of a biogeo graphical link between Bhutan and the Indian state of Meghalaya. Based primarily on DNA data, Indosuccinea crassinuclea is considered a widespread species, distributed from northern India and Bhutan southwards to even Sri Lanka and The Maldives.
